Where does e-waste end up? (Greenpeace, 02.09)

Many old electronic goods gather dust in storage waiting to be reused, recycled or thrown away. The US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) estimates that as much as three quarters of the computers sold in the US are stockpiled in garages and closets. When thrown away, they end up in landfills or incinerators or, more recently, are exported to Asia. - landfill : décharge - leach : filtrer - furan : furazolidone - to bio accumulate : être bioaccumulable (ne pouvant être éliminés par un organisme vivant) - Brominated flame retardants : Retardateurs de flammes bromés - Polyvinyl chloride : PVC (polychlorure de vinyle) - facility (areas unlikely to have waste facilities) : service - purpose-built : ad hoc - scrap yard : dépôt de ferraille / cimetière de voiture > to scrap : mettre à la casse - sheer : pure > it's sheer madness
